Hinchey Statement on President Signing Whole Milk for Healthy Kids Act
January 14, 2026
KINGSTON, NY – New York State Senate Agriculture Chair Michelle Hinchey issued the following statement after President Donald Trump signed the Whole Milk for Healthy Kids Act into law:
“Dairy is New York’s leading agricultural sector, and for years, we’ve been pushing federal leaders to pass the Whole Milk for Healthy Kids Act, because it will boost economic stability for our dairy farmers and healthier choices for students across the state. Today, our fight has paid off, and New York can put this law to work, giving farmers back a critical market for their businesses, strengthening rural economies, and making sure students have a wholesome option on their trays. Supporting the farmers who feed us, and keeping their businesses competitive, should be a priority at every level of government, and this new law is a welcome win for New York dairy.”
